    Team Member, E-fraud Monitoring

    Job Objective (s)

    • Conduct a thorough review and analysis of all transactions that are flagged on the card fraud management platforms to ascertain their integrity and authenticity.
    • It also involves timely and proactive assessment of the effectiveness of the set rules and continuous dimensioning of the various fraud scenarios across all card schemes and performing root cause analysis.

    Responsibilities

    • Ensure that team members conduct a continuous review of all flagged transactions on card fraud management tools.
    • Ensure that customers are contacted in a timely manner to confirm the authenticity of flagged transactions
    • Follow-up on an escalation of suspicious transactions but unreachable customers to account holding branches.
    • Confirm that compromised cards are promptly blocked.
    • Ensure immediate logging of fraud cases for investigation of fraud & investigation of customer complaint management (CCM)
    • Periodic review of rules to cater for the dynamism of fraud patterns
    • Daily reporting of all cases treated in the approved format
    • Periodic gap analysis and correlation of all card fraud incidences
    • Proper documentation of events and issues
    • Periodic reporting of team activities and achievement to the management (board risk, IT steering committee and department)
    • Follow-up with the supporting vendors to ensure optimum availability and integrity of the various card fraud monitoring tools
    • Follow-up on reported security incident to resolution.
